Origin of the Name

The surname Quingey is believed to have originated from the region of Franche-Comté in eastern France. It is derived from the name of a small village called Quingey, which is located in the Doubs department of the country. The name of the village itself is said to have Celtic origins, with some sources suggesting that it means "place of the waters" in the ancient language.
